1. Gecko stalks caterpillar more than half its own size

    Gecko stalks caterpillar more than half its own size

    4
    0
    18.9K
  2. Gecko successfully emerges from its tiny egg

    Gecko successfully emerges from its tiny egg

    7
    0
    8.89K